    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market Summary

    The Japan Cancer Immunotherapy market is projected to grow significantly from 2.63 USD Billion in 2024 to 5.98 USD Billion by 2035.

    Key Market Trends & Highlights

    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Key Trends and Highlights

    • The market is expected to exp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.75 percent from 2025 to 2035.
    • By 2035, the market valuation is anticipated to reach 5.98 USD Billion, indicating robust growth potential.
    • In 2024, the market is valued at 2.63 USD Billion, reflecting the current investment landscape in cancer immunotherapy.
    • Growing adoption of innovative therapies due to increasing cancer prevalence is a major market driver.

    Market Size & Forecast

    2024 Market Size 2.63 (USD Billion)
    2035 Market Size 5.98 (USD Billion)
    CAGR (2025-2035) 7.75%

    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market Trends

    The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market is expanding due to rising cancer cases along with advances in biotechnology. The Japanese government has been aggressively funding and promoted R&D for cancer treatment along with precision medicine which aids on the adoption of immunotherapy products designed specifically for Japanese patients. Consequently, there is a rise in the collaboration pharmaceutical companies with research and academic institutions. Furthermore, the aged population in Japan leads to increased cancer cases which motivates a large adoption of immunotherapy among healthcare providers.

    The development of healthcare infrastructure in Japan, including both rural and urban areas, poses a great opportunity which can facilitate implementation of immunotherapy. Furthermore, Japan's regulatory policies for medical treatment are also changing, easing the approval of new therapies thereby aiding their incorporation into the healthcare system. There is increasing awareness among healthcare professionals concerning the positive impacts of immunotherapy which, paired with the rising interest toward combination therapies meant to improve treatment effectiveness in the region’s common cancers, leads to an increased support.

    Recent trends exhibit a growing adoption of unconventional treatment methods, fueled by successful campaigns of breakthrough therapies. The Japanese market experienced higher patient awareness and physician education regarding the value of immunotherapy, which led to a greater number of clinical trials being started at a local level. In addition, local research facilities are concentrating on biomanufacturing to develop a strong regional supply chain for immunotherapy products. This combination of local R&D, demographics of the patient population, and favorable policies make Japan an important country in the global map of cancer immunotherapy development.

    Cancer Immunotherapy Market Therapy Type Insights

    The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market is witnessing significant growth within its Therapy Type segment, driven by advanced scientific research and a growing understanding of cancer mechanisms. Among the various approaches, Monoclonal Antibodies have gained prominence for their ability to target specific cancer cells, enhancing the effectiveness of treatment while minimizing side effects. This specificity is critical in a country like Japan, where precision in healthcare is a growing priority.

    Check Point Inhibitors are also becoming increasingly important within this market, as they effectively unlock the immune system's ability to combat tumors, marking a shift in treatment philosophy from traditional methods to immunotherapy.

    Their role in treating various cancers, such as melanoma and lung cancer, emphasizes their increasing relevance in Japan's healthcare landscape. Cancer Vaccines represent another critical approach in the market, helping to prevent cancer by training the immune system to attack cancer cells, thus utilizing Japan's advanced technology in vaccine development. With ongoing advancements, Japan is poised to leverage its robust Research and Development environment to enhance vaccine efficacy, contributing significantly to the overall market.

    Therapeutic T-Cells, which utilize genetically engineered cells to target cancer, are gaining attention for their innovative approach to treatment, highlighting Japan's commitment to being at the forefront of cutting-edge therapies.

    Finally, Oncolytic Virus Therapy, which employs viruses to selectively infect and destroy cancer cells, showcases the potential for novel treatment strategies that align with Japan's emphasis on innovation in healthcare. The diverse Therapy Type landscape within the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market reveals a multifaceted approach to battling cancer, marking crucial steps towards improving patient outcomes and establishing the nation as a leader in the global cancer treatment arena. This sector is characterized by continual advancements and collaborative efforts among academia, pharmaceutical companies, and government institutions, reflecting the dynamic nature of the market.

    Industry Developments

    The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market has seen significant developments in recent months, with companies like Merck and Co, Novartis, Ono Pharmaceutical, and Daiichi Sankyo actively expanding their portfolios. Notably, in October 2023, Roche announced advancements in their immuno-oncology pipeline, focusing on combination therapies that enhance the efficacy of existing treatments. Additionally, Takeda Pharmaceutical reported collaborations aimed at improving patient access to innovative therapies, emphasizing their commitment to accelerate research in this field.

    The market valuation has notably increased, driven by both advancements in technology and growing investment in Research and Development by companies such as Astellas Pharma and Pfizer. Competitive dynamics are further enhanced by recent partnerships between players like Kite Pharma and Mitsubishi Tanabe Pharma aimed at co-developing cutting-edge treatments. In August 2023, Eisai and Chugai Pharmaceutical made headlines by entering a strategic alliance to leverage their respective expertise in immunotherapy.

    The cumulative efforts of these organizations reflect the robust growth trajectory and innovation within the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market, which is supported by government initiatives promoting research, alongside an increasing patient population seeking advanced treatment options.

    FAQs

    What is the projected market size of the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market in 2024?

    The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market is projected to be valued at 2.63 billion USD in 2024.

    What is the expected market size of the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market by 2035?

    By 2035, the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market is expected to reach a valuation of 5.98 billion USD.

    What is the expected CAGR for the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market from 2025 to 2035?

    The expected CAGR for the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market from 2025 to 2035 is 7.754 percent.

    Which therapy type holds the largest market share in 2024 within the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market?

    In 2024, Monoclonal Antibodies hold the largest market share, valued at 1.05 billion USD.

    What is the market value for Check Point Inhibitors in 2024 in the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market?

    The market value for Check Point Inhibitors in 2024 is estimated to be 0.85 billion USD.

    Who are the key players in the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market?

    Key players in the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market include Merck & Co, Novartis, Ono Pharmaceutical, and Daiichi Sankyo.

    What is the growth rate for Cancer Vaccines in the Japan Cancer Immunotherapy Market from 2024 to 2035?

    The market for Cancer Vaccines is expected to grow from 0.5 billion USD in 2024 to 1.05 billion USD by 2035.

    How much is the market for Therapeutic T-Cells expected to be valued in 2035?

    The market for Therapeutic T-Cells is expected to be valued at 0.35 billion USD by 2035.
